PHP服务器的安全性直接关系到网站的数据和用户隐私。强化PHP服务器安全需要从多个层面入手,包括配置、代码、权限管理等方面。
•确保PHP版本是最新的,避免使用已知存在漏洞的旧版本。定期更新PHP及其扩展,可以有效防止因已知漏洞导致的攻击。
•合理配置服务器环境,关闭不必要的服务和端口,减少攻击面。同时,禁用危险函数如eval()、exec()等,防止恶意代码执行。
在代码层面,应严格过滤用户输入,避免SQL注入和XSS攻击。使用预处理语句进行数据库操作,并对输出内容进行转义处理。

2026AI生成内容,仅供参考
权限管理同样重要,应遵循最小权限原则,限制文件和目录的访问权限,避免Web目录暴露敏感信息。同时,设置合理的错误提示,避免泄露系统细节。
定期进行安全审计和日志分析,能够及时发现潜在威胁。利用防火墙和入侵检测系统,进一步提升服务器的防御能力。
•建立完善的备份机制,确保在遭遇攻击时能够快速恢复数据,降低损失。